09:58Few projects in Marvel's cinematic universe have divided people like She-Hulk.
10:13While some think it's a funny meta-commentary,
10:17the detractors say it's an insult to Marvel's cinematic universe
10:22and point out the meme of Megan Thee Stallion as proof.
10:31The fans have argued that there's a double standard,
10:34saying that if Deadpool messed with the rapper, there wouldn't be such a speech.
10:39To a certain extent we agree, but there's a key difference,
10:43the coherence.
10:44Even when he's emotionally involved, Deadpool never takes anything so seriously.
10:58Jennifer Walters wants her to take it seriously as a lawyer,
11:01but occasionally she acts like a first year college student.
11:06So when you see her messing with Buddy's singer, it may seem strange.
11:11Anyway, Tatiana Maslany said that filming the scene was the best day and moment of her life.
11:25Number 2, Axl's head, Thor, Love and Thunder.
11:30With Thor Ragnarok, Marvel's cinematic universe and director Taika Waititi were in their heyday.
11:38When they crossed paths again, they were both going through difficult creative moments.
11:44If you thought Thor, Love and Thunder would be the energy injection Marvel and Waititi needed,
11:50we recommend you watch Thor, Love and Thunder.
11:55If that's not enough to show our point, here's this mediocre effect.
11:59For a movie that has amazing visual effects, this looks like SpongeBob.
12:24Leaving aside the effects, the interaction between Thor and Astrid, we mean Axl,
12:30is just not fun.
12:32The filmmakers apparently thought otherwise, since the story goes on forever.
12:46We appreciate that Marvel has a sense of humor, but not all scenes need to force the joke.

13:04Number 1, M.O.D.O.K., Ant-Man and the Wasp, Quantum Mania.
13:10Darren is dead! There is only M.O.D.O.K.!
13:15For a movie about Ant-Man and the Wasp, Quantum Mania focused more on making fun of Kang and his variants.
13:23We all know how that ended.
13:25Although the controversy of Jonathan Mayers did not help, Kang is not the biggest problem in Quantum Mania.
13:32That would be M.O.D.O.K.
13:34And here we are again.
13:37Face to face.
13:41That's a face. It's a...
13:44It's a big face.
13:45Well, let's be fair. The design of this character in the comics is already quite silly.
13:51Translating it to a photorealistic environment was always going to be a challenge.
13:56That said, his stretched face is not only ridiculously bad for a multimillion dollar movie.
14:02The character is frankly unpleasant to see, which makes us wish he would stay with the mask on.
14:15Even if he had something funny to say, we are too busy wondering how a Marvel Cinematic Universe movie has less attractive effects than Sharkboy and Lavagirl.
